Bipartisan Mayors Urge Congress, Administration to Deliver Relief for Cities Still Reeling From Pandemic
September 26, 2020
WASHINGTON, Sept. 26 -- The U.S. Conference of Mayors issued the following news release on Sept. 25:

The U.S. Conference of Mayors (USCM) is again urging congressional and administration leaders to return to the negotiating table and pass a bipartisan COVID-19 relief package that includes emergency fiscal assistance to cities of all sizes.
